A carefully extended, remodelled and refreshed modern residence with a wonderfully spacious and light interior which takes full advantage of the delightful semi-rural location and uninterrupted countryside views.

The property provides exceptionally versatile, bespoke accommodation of undoubted quality that will satisfy the most demanding and discerning buyer home buyer, with both wonderful entertaining space and ample provision for homeworking.

Extending to over 2,000 square feet, the well-planned layout features a reception hall with study area, sitting room and family room/bedroom 3, both with doors to the conservatory and views over the garden and countryside beyond: A beautifully crafted kitchen/breakfast room with granite counters and a wealth of quality cabinets and a useful and practical home office/studio with adjacent utility/preparation area. The family bathroom has been fully refitted and the master bedroom has an en suite wet room/shower and also a picture window and glazed door opening onto the rear garden.

Occupying a mature plot of around a quarter of an acre and approached via a sweeping block-paved drive, the property is set back from the road with ample off-road parking and a double garage.

Location

The small village of Buckworth is delightfully situated, surrounded by open countryside and farmland yet is within easy reach of both the A1 and the recently upgraded A14. The village features a pleasant blend of modern and period properties set around the C12th All-Saints Church and Buckworth Cricket Club. Local shopping facilities can be found both at the post office and general store at Alconbury and at nearby Spaldwick, with its pub/restaurant and excellent services with petrol station, Little Waitrose, Costa and Greggs. Education is at a premium in this area with an excellent choice of both primary and secondary education as well as some of the area�s leading public schools at Kimbolton and Oundle. The market towns of Huntingdon (7 miles) and St Neots (13 miles) offer a host of shopping and recreational facilities as well as a main line train stations providing a commuter service to London�s Kings Cross.
